KubeEdge邊緣自治設計原理

2021-10-04 16:40:49 字數 637 閱讀 1887

專案位址(歡迎star、watch、fork):

答1:kubeedge構建在k8s原生的排程與編排能力之上,它負責將應用的元資料可靠的下發到邊緣節點。邊緣端週期性上報狀態node、pod資訊,會不斷重試上報,因此目前還未計畫實現排隊及ack校驗等功能。

答2:如果是新人剛開始參與社群,可以做一些簡單的工作,例如補齊文件、新增測試用例等,社群會有標籤為「help wanted」或「good first issue」的issue,都適用於新手開發者。

答4:kubeedge構建在k8s原生的排程與編排能力之上,與k8s的api是100%相容的,對於k8s的api物件可以使用k8s原生的client來操作。kubeedge中自定義的device crd後續也會按k8s標準生成golang語言的client。因此可以按照k8s原生的方式來操作kubeedge。

答5:如果出現程式自動退出、重啟的問題,建議檢視對應的應用日誌,將問題及日誌以issue的方式提到社群解決。

答6:首先考慮edgecore重啟不會引起節點業務pod的重啟,如果是邊緣節點宕機引起整個節點的重啟,應該考慮該pod是否已經遷移到其他節點。

KubeEdge與邊緣計算

邊緣特指計算資源在地理分布上更加靠近裝置,而遠離雲資料中心的資源節點,可以理解為是近場計算。典型的邊緣計算分為物聯網 智慧型城市,智慧型家居等 和非物聯網 cdn 等 場景。隨著網際網路智慧型終端裝置數量的急劇增加,以及 5g 和物聯網時代的到來,傳統雲計算中心集中儲存 計算的模式已經無法滿足終端裝...

KubeEdge裝置管理設計原理

專案位址 歡迎star watch fork 課後問題 a 1 只要客戶端的arm裝置能夠執行kubeedge邊緣節點 256m記憶體 執行容器 且能夠連線到雲端,就可以使用kubeedge來管理。a3 kubeedge的主要場景之一就是邊緣節點處在私有網路。首先邊緣節點連線位於公網的管理面節點,建...

KubeEdge的雲邊協同設計原理

1.雲端元件與k8s master的關係 cloudcore和k8s master,非侵入的對映 2.edgecontroller詳解 邊緣節點管理 應用狀態元資料雲邊協同 3.devicecontroller詳解 devicemodel 裝置模版抽象 定義裝置通用支援的屬性 deviceinsta...